#506e4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#506e4c is composed of 31.4% red, 43.1%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 112.9 degrees, a saturation of 18.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#506e4c color hex could be obtained by blending #a0dc98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#506e4c color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#506e4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#506e4c has RGB values of R:80, G:110,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 5271116.

Shades and Tints of #506e4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040604 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#506e4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b605a is the less saturated color, while #19b604 is the most saturated one.
